TAKEN: a UFO horror game set on a Montana farm
TAKEN is a free, first-person UFO horror game that plays instantly in your web browser with nothing to install. You tend an isolated farm in rural Montana by day and survive escalating alien encounters by night. It is a slow-burn dread, not a jump-scare ride: a working homestead, a full day and night cycle, lamplight and parchment tones, hand-tuned ambient sound, and procedurally generated mountains. Built in Three.js and WebGL by VOIDMODE GAMES.
How to play TAKEN
- Move with WASD, look with the mouse, sprint with Shift, jump with Space, crouch with C.
- Drive the farm truck with E, plant and harvest corn with F, and fish the pond with G.
- Hold right mouse button for the torch. Its battery drains, so recharge from glowing pickups.
- Raise binoculars with middle mouse button to scan the treeline and the sky.
- Press T to speed up time. Click the screen to lock the mouse and play. Press Escape to release it.
What happens at night
On the first night a silent watcher stands at a distance and always faces you, vanishing if you get close. From the second night on, a hunter walks steadily toward you, slow enough to flee but relentless. If it reaches you, a UFO descends on a beam, the world whites out, and you are taken. A craft also hovers over the homestead and bolts if you hold it in direct sight. Hide in the cornfield, manage your torch, and finish each day's objectives while staying out of the sky's reach.
About TAKEN
Genre: first-person survival horror with an alien abduction theme. Platform: any modern desktop web browser with WebGL. Price: free, no download and no sign-up. Engine: Three.js with TypeScript and Vite. Play TAKEN in your browser, read the plain-text summary, or view the source on GitHub.
